Default So the Wagon is booked in for some beefing up...

Finally got the '03 wagon booked in with Extreme Scoobies for its VF35 turbo upgrade (along with fuel pump, injectors and decat/sportscat exhaust mods).


Hopefully 330BHP here we come! Just in time for Le Mans too!

VF35, 290 fuel pump,3 port boost solenoid, STI inlet with TGV Deletes, STi Up pipe, RCM Bellmouth downpipe, 3" full decat nurspec, K&N Typhoon induction, FMIC, Mafless Carberry Map with Antilag. Mapped by Duncan Graham
